Across TCGA cell cohorts, ZNF343 mutation is significantly associated with the RNA expression of many other genes, with 9 significant associations in total. STOMACH shows the largest number of these associations.

The most reproducible ZNF343-associated genes across cancer lineages are KCNG4, USP17L4, and RLN3. Each is linked with ZNF343 in more than 1 cancer types. Because this analysis shows association rather than direction, both ZNF343-to-partner and partner-to-ZNF343 results are reported.
